Innovations and Responsible Gaming Initiatives
Leading online casinos are now integrating features such as real-time deposit limits, self-exclusion tools, and personalized player warnings. These innovations are driven by data indicating that early intervention can significantly reduce gambling harm. For instance, a 2021 study from the Gambling Commission of New Zealand showed that players using responsible gaming tools were 30% less likely to develop problematic behaviors.
Additionally, industry leaders are leveraging data analytics to monitor gambling patterns and flag risky behaviors proactively. This approach aligns with global trends emphasizing ethically responsible design—shifting from reactive to preventive measures.
